Actually for most waves Ninjago has been very clever in putting some diferentiation in the henchmen and minions. There is a perception of ranking. The Snake waves show it best where each snake clan had the Leader with snake legs. The 2nd with Leader head but human legs. The upper minion with the clan style head and normal legs and the low man clan type head with short legs. You see a similar pattern in the Stone Army. And to lesser degrees in most other waves. The only ones that went full generic bad guys were this last waves Red Visors group. For Monkey Kid they gave each Bull a name. Some minor difference, be it horn color or arm color would have greatly helped.

Honestly I think the Master of the Mountain wave’s a lot worse about the ‘identical bad guys’ thing. There’s exactly four different minifigure designs (and I don’t count the goblin and troll variants where they just slapped a hood on or removed the shoulder armour because there’s no difference in the prints) that are repeated a lot, and that’s including the Skull Sorceror himself. Plus, the ‘Awakened Warriors’ only have one print on their whole bodies so really there’s only three minifigure villain designs across this whole wave. It’s not a good precedent to set.

Monkie Kid recycling the Bull Demon grunts is annoying, but they have the unique designs for Princess Iron Fan and Red Son, and they actually do have different-coloured arms and a cape for General . . Iron something? I forget . . plus apparently there’s three more sets that’ll include the Spider Queen, Goldhorn and Silverhorn (probably have those wrong, sorry) so those will probably be unique and interesting. It certainly could be worse. 

Also, on the topic of the Serpentine, that was definitely a high point for the theme; they came up with no less than seventeen minifigure designs that each consisted of three or four prints, as well as eight new moulds, just for the Serpentine. I wish we still got that level of detail . .
